Reportedly it is going to be the most powerful gaming console till date.  Let's see what specs it has to offer: Project Scorpio's CPU will feature 8 custom x86 cores clocked at 2.3GHz -- well above the original system's 1.75GHz, and even higher than the PS4 Pro's 2.1GHz. The GPU is built around 40 customized compute units at 1172MHz, which will provide a more stable and higher frame rate with faster load times. That far exceeds the Xbox One's 12GCN compute units at 853MHz, and beats the PS4 Pro's 36 improved GCN compute units at 911MHz. Guetzli is an encoder developed by Google that allows JPEG files to be compressed as much as 35 percent, resulting in much faster Web page loading. "Guetzli," which means "cookie" in Swiss German, allows users to create smaller JPEG images while maintaining compatibility with existing Web browsers, image processing applications and the existing JPEG standard. > How does it enhance browsing speed? IBM's supermachine 'WATSON'

Watson is an IBM supercomputer that combines artificial intelligence (AI) and sophisticated analytical software for optimal performance as a “question answering” machine. The supercomputer is named for IBM’s founder, Thomas J. Watson. The Watson supercomputer processes at a rate of 80 teraflops (trillion floating-point operations per second). To replicate (or surpass) a high-functioning human’s ability to answer questions, Watson accesses 90 servers with a combined data store of over 200 million pages of information, which it processes against six million logic rules. The device and its data are self-contained in a space that could accommodate 10 refrigerators.
